Feed Editor, an RSS Feed Creation Tool

Feed Editor, a software tool designed to create, edit and publish RSS feeds, has been released by Extralabs Software. Now, with Feed Editor, webmasters have the ability to create new RSS feeds from scratch, or modify and enhance existing RSS feeds.

RSS is an acronym for Really Simple Syndication, an XML format for distributing news headlines on the Web. RSS has evolved into a popular means to syndicate headlines and share content on the Internet.

Feed Editor makes RSS feed creation easy. The Feed Editor wizard walks new users through the RSS feed setup process, delivering ease of use and conformance to specifications. Feed Editor automatically repairs improperly formatted feeds, guaranteeing that all feeds used with Feed Editor, conform to the RSS specification. Feed Editor can be used to create and maintain an unlimited number of RSS feeds, enabling users to flawlessly maintain and distribute multiple content streams.

Integrated tools like live spell checking, WYSIWYG HTML editing, and image manipulation combine to deliver a powerful tool for webmasters. Advanced features empower web developers with automated feed creation and scheduling capabilities.

In today's business environment, increased communication is not a luxury, it is a priority. Extralabs Software recognizes the need for reliable streams of communication, and has added a number of features into Feed Editor to assist webmasters with content development.

Feed Editor requires Windows 98, ME, NT, 2000, XP or Vista running on a Pentium-class computer. Feed Editor costs $39.95, and may be purchased securely online at http://www.extralabs.net/. You can download a free fully-functional 30-day trial from the same web address.
